Pakistan Extends Power Outages Amid Electricity Shortage Crisis

πŸ“Œ Summary

Power outages across Pakistan will intensify due to a sustained electricity shortage caused by reduced generation capacity and fuel supply issues. The government is exploring options to mitigate the crisis.


Pakistan is experiencing extended power outages in several regions due to an ongoing electricity shortage crisis. Authorities have announced that load shedding schedules will be increased to conserve limited energy resources amid rising demand and diminished supply. The shortage is attributed to reduced generation capacity and delays in fuel supply, complicating the already fragile power infrastructure. These blackouts are affecting industries, businesses, and households, raising concerns about the economic and social impact. Government officials are in talks with energy providers to find solutions, including potential imports and ramping up domestic production. Meanwhile, residents are urged to prepare for intermittent power cuts in the coming weeks as the country navigates this challenging period.
